What is a Lithium Battery Electric Bellows Stop Valve?

A Lithium Battery Electric Bellows Stop Valve is a type of valve that uses electric actuation powered by a lithium-ion battery, coupled with a bellows design to regulate fluid flow. The valve incorporates a unique mechanism in which the bellows (a flexible, accordion-like element) seals the valve shut or opens it to allow fluid flow. The electric actuator, powered by a rechargeable lithium battery, controls the motion of the bellows, enabling precise and automatic control over fluid regulation. This type of valve is especially valuable in situations where power sources are limited or where traditional pneumatic or hydraulic systems are not feasible. With a focus on energy efficiency and environmental friendliness, the lithium battery provides a long-lasting, low-maintenance power source. The integration of electric actuation and bellows technology makes it ideal for remote or hard-to-reach locations, where power and maintenance access may be challenging.
